Business and Professional Services

As professional and business services firms expand in complexity and global presence, Simpson Thacher partners with them to navigate their most transformational events.

Our lawyers work closely with professional services partnerships and other business services on strategic transactions, including carve-outs, reorganizations and IPOs. We have a strong understanding of the trends shaping industries such as advertising, legal, employment services, IT and software services, management consulting and outsourcing.

We have particular experience establishing alternative practice structures for accounting firms and representing private equity sponsors investing in such alternative practice structures. Our lawyers regularly negotiate all aspects of a deal, including governance arrangements, management equity plans, employment agreements, administrative services agreements and the overall design and execution.


Advised on 6 of 9 deals involving PE investment in the 2024 Accounting Today’s Top 25 Accounting Firms List
